The circular FlatGallery with Hood features a slotted surface that prevents raindrops from directly hitting the building. In addition, the backboards contain holes to let water out to prevent the accumulation of dew.

Sugita also announced the release of the 'Ten-key Box' key storage unit. The box is H1790 x W400 x L450cm, with three types depending on the number of keys it can store (360 keys, 540 keys and 630 keys).
